Victor Davis Hanson presents a brilliant overview of the post-modern, politically correct rules of warfare subsumed under what he calls the "Gaza Rules." The most pernicious of them being both sides are guilty of starting a war. In practice, its usually the stronger party to a conflict that gets the blame. To post-modern minds in the West, neither the context nor the moral cupability of the sides to a war matter. Its akin as he puts it, to the "politically correct zero tolerance policies of our public schools where both the bully and his victim are suspended once physical violence occurs." The basic point of the asymmetrical Gaza Rules really is no one has to use their judgment because judgment is in and of itself a bad thing. So that is where we are today. Hanson doesn't say they're right but they are a fact of life.
